Small BusinessBEML Q3 net dips 21% to Rs 46 cr
Public Sector engineering major BEML today reported a decline of 20.61 per cent in net profit at Rs 46.6 crore for the third quarter ended December 31, 2009, over the same period last year.

However, total income rose to Rs 709 crore for the quarter ended December 31, from Rs 680 crore in the same period previous fiscal, BEML said in a filing to the Bombay Stock Exchange.
Shares of BEML were trading at Rs 1,065 on the BSE, up 2.26 per cent from previous close.
